Top job projections for graduates in english language and literature from university of alaska southeast

English language and literature teachers, postsecondary

Projection Rating: C

Median Annual Wage: $78,130

Percentage of Paycheck to Repay: 24.66%-18.35%

Employment Change: 0.8%

Entry-Level Education: Doctoral or professional degree

Writers and authors

Projection Rating: A-

Median Annual Wage: $73,690

Percentage of Paycheck to Repay: 8.72%-6.49%

Employment Change: 7.7%

Entry-Level Education: Bachelor's degree

The English Language and Literature Degree from the University of Alaska Southeast (UAS) offers students a unique opportunity to delve into the complexities of language, culture, and literature while preparing for a rewarding career. Understanding the return on investment (ROI) of this degree is essential for prospective students considering their educational and financial futures.

Graduates of the UAS English Language and Literature program develop critical thinking, analytical, and communication skills that are highly valued in today’s job market. These skills open doors to a variety of career paths, including education, writing, editing, publishing, and marketing. The ability to understand and interpret texts, coupled with strong writing capabilities, makes graduates attractive candidates for employers across multiple industries.

According to recent data, the ROI of a degree in English Language and Literature is substantial. Graduates from UAS have reported competitive starting salaries, with many earning above the national average for entry-level positions. Furthermore, the skills acquired during the program provide a solid foundation for advanced studies, potentially leading to even higher earnings and career advancement opportunities.

Moreover, the UAS English program emphasizes real-world experience through internships and community engagement, giving students practical knowledge that enhances their employability. The connections made during these experiences can be invaluable in securing post-graduation positions.
